;(function() { window.createMeasureObserver = (measureName) => { var markPrefix = `_uol-measure-${measureName}-${new Date().getTime()}`; performance.mark(`${markPrefix}-start`); return { end: function() { performance.mark(`${markPrefix}-end`); performance.measure(`uol-measure-${measureName}`, `${markPrefix}-start`, `${markPrefix}-end`); performance.clearMarks(`${markPrefix}-start`); performance.clearMarks(`${markPrefix}-end`); } } }; /** * Gerenciador de eventos */ window.gevent = { stack: [], RUN_ONCE: true, on: function(name, callback, once) { this.stack.push([name, callback, !!once]); }, emit: function(name, args) { for (var i = this.stack.length, item; i--;) { item = this.stack[i]; if (item[0] === name) { item[1](args); if (item[2]) { this.stack.splice(i, 1); } } } } }; var runningSearch = false; var hadAnEvent = true; var elementsToWatch = window.elementsToWatch = new Map(); var innerHeight = window.innerHeight; // timestamp da última rodada do requestAnimationFrame // É usado para limitar a procura por elementos visíveis. var lastAnimationTS = 0; // verifica se elemento está no viewport do usuário var isElementInViewport = function(el) { var rect = el.getBoundingClientRect(); var clientHeight = window.innerHeight || document.documentElement.clientHeight; // renderizando antes, evitando troca de conteúdo visível no chartbeat-related-content if(el.className.includes('related-content-front')) return true; // garante que usa ao mínimo 280px de margem para fazer o lazyload var margin = clientHeight + Math.max(280, clientHeight * 0.2); // se a base do componente está acima da altura da tela do usuário, está oculto if(rect.bottom < 0 && rect.bottom > margin * -1) { return false; } // se o topo do elemento está abaixo da altura da tela do usuário, está oculto if(rect.top > margin) { return false; } // se a posição do topo é negativa, verifica se a altura dele ainda // compensa o que já foi scrollado if(rect.top < 0 && rect.height + rect.top < 0) { return false; } return true; }; var asynxNextFreeTime = () => { return new Promise((resolve) => { if(window.requestIdleCallback) { window.requestIdleCallback(resolve, { timeout: 5000, }); } else { window.requestAnimationFrame(resolve); } }); }; var asyncValidateIfElIsInViewPort = function(promise, el) { return promise.then(() => { if(el) { if(isElementInViewport(el) == true) { const cb = elementsToWatch.get(el); // remove da lista para não ser disparado novamente elementsToWatch.delete(el); cb(); } } }).then(asynxNextFreeTime); }; // inicia o fluxo de procura de elementos procurados var look = function() { if(window.requestIdleCallback) { window.requestIdleCallback(findByVisibleElements, { timeout: 5000, }); } else { window.requestAnimationFrame(findByVisibleElements); } }; var findByVisibleElements = function(ts) { var elapsedSinceLast = ts - lastAnimationTS; // se não teve nenhum evento que possa alterar a página if(hadAnEvent == false) { return look(); } if(elementsToWatch.size == 0) { return look(); } if(runningSearch == true) { return look(); } // procura por elementos visíveis apenas 5x/seg if(elapsedSinceLast < 1000/5) { return look(); } // atualiza o último ts lastAnimationTS = ts; // reseta status de scroll para não entrar novamente aqui hadAnEvent = false; // indica que está rodando a procura por elementos no viewport runningSearch = true; const done = Array.from(elementsToWatch.keys()).reduce(asyncValidateIfElIsInViewPort, Promise.resolve()); // obtém todos os elementos que podem ter view contabilizados //elementsToWatch.forEach(function(cb, el) { // if(isElementInViewport(el) == true) { // // remove da lista para não ser disparado novamente // elementsToWatch.delete(el); // cb(el); // } //}); done.then(function() { runningSearch = false; }); // reinicia o fluxo de procura look(); }; /** * Quando o elemento `el` entrar no viewport (-20%), cb será disparado. */ window.lazyload = function(el, cb) { if(el.nodeType != Node.ELEMENT_NODE) { throw new Error("element parameter should be a Element Node"); } if(typeof cb !== 'function') { throw new Error("callback parameter should be a Function"); } elementsToWatch.set(el, cb); } var setEvent = function() { hadAnEvent = true; }; window.addEventListener('scroll', setEvent, { capture: true, ive: true }); window.addEventListener('click', setEvent, { ive: true }); window.addEventListener('resize', setEvent, { ive: true }); window.addEventListener('load', setEvent, { once: true, ive: true }); window.addEventListener('DOMContentLoaded', setEvent, { once: true, ive: true }); window.gevent.on('allJSLoadedAndCreated', setEvent, window.gevent.RUN_ONCE); // inicia a validação look(); })();
  • AssineUOL
Topo

Acusação de assédio e punições: a trajetória de Bruno Gaga no BBB 23

BBB 23: Bruno é um dos participantes da Pipoca - Divulgação/Globo
BBB 23: Bruno é um dos participantes da Pipoca Imagem: Divulgação/Globo

Colaboração para Splash, em São Paulo

17/02/2023 19h42

Bruno apertou o botão de desistência de saiu do BBB 23 (Globo). Após uma Prova do Líder marcada pela resistência, a ansiedade venceu o brother, que apertou o botão durante a tarde.

A agem do atendente de farmácia pelo reality show foi marcada por embates com Fred Nicácio e algumas acusações de assédio contra Gabriel Santana. Confira os destaques!

Conflitos com Fred Nicácio

Bruno e Fred Nicácio tiveram alguns conflitos durante a estadia do atendente de farmácia na casa. Os dois não discutiram diretamente, mas com frequência falaram mal um do outro para aliados.

Em um papo com Domitila, Fred Nicácio não poupou críticas às atitudes de Bruno.

Nicácio: "É engraçado para quem? Eles acharam que eu ia bater boca com ele [Bruno]. Gente, eu não sou assim. Eu estou em outro nível"

O médico continuou o discurso, afirmando: "Ele é assim, barraqueiro, escandaloso, espalhafatoso. Não vou chegar ao nível dele. Eu vou falar de outro lugar. Sou uma pessoal intelectual"

Já o atendente de farmácia acusou Nicácio de disseminar fake news sobre ele.

Bruno. "No Jogo da Discórdia ele não esperava, de novo, eu rebater ele. E acho que ele [Nicácio] disse 'vamos [votar] nele', porque eu escutei".

Bruno. "Ele pode ter dito várias coisas. Fake news, com certeza. Porque eu acho que ele não ouviu nada de mim. Eu acho que ele fez a cabeça de muitos lá, porque muitos são influenciáveis. E estão caindo na onda dele".

Punições e acusações

Bruno levou diversas punições após os famosos "after dos crias", por exagerar na bebida e mexer com os móveis da casa.

Além disso, em uma das festas do programa, Bruno tentou beijar Gabriel Santana e o ator se esquivou. Mesmo assim, Bruno continuou na empreitada e, nas redes socias, alguns espectadores reagiram à situação.

Os dois estavam dançando na festa. Depois que se aproximaram, Bruno tentou, em mais de uma ocasião, beijar o famoso, que pontuou que não queria ficar com o brother.

Em outra festa, Bruno levou um "atenção" da produção do programa ao tentar agarrar Gabriel Santana.

O ator estava em pé, quando Bruno o puxou pela cintura e o sentou em seu colo.

Paula, que estava sentada perto dos dois, o alertou para o aviso: "Bruno, atenção".

Foi amigo de Gabriel

Após a eliminação de Gabriel no segundo Paredão, Bruno se emocionou no Quarto Deserto. Enquanto chorava, o brother foi consolado por Aline Wirley.

Quando questionado por que estava emocionado, o atendente de farmácia afirmou que estava triste devido à saída de Gabriel.

Bruno: "Aqui é um misto de sensações. Tem umas pessoas aqui que só de estar perto, a energia é ruim, não gosto"

Bruno: "Aqui é convivência. Lá fora a gente escolhe [com quem se relacionar], aqui dentro não tem como"

Aline: "Chora o que tem que chorar. É triste mesmo. Você e Gabriel criaram uma sintonia"

Bruno: "Parecíamos irmãos, né? Brigávamos e depois já estávamos nos amando"

Contou ser bissexual

Bruno, Ricardo e Sarah Aline bateram um papo sobre bissexualidade no BBB 23. Os três comentaram suas experiências descobrindo a própria sexualidade.

Bruno Gaga disse que se entende como bissexual, Sarah também. Já Ricardo contou sua experiência ficando com um homem.

"Numa viagem pra Recife, eu beijei mais mulher do que homem. Sou bi(ssexual). Eu gosto só do beijo da mulher. O beijo da mulher é mágico, eu acho", disse Bruno.

Apertou o botão de desistência

Após a Prova do Líder, que contou com a resistência dos participantes, os brothers descansavam. Bruno, então, apertou o botão de desistência durante a tarde.

Grande parte dos brothers se emocionou com a desistência de Bruno.

"Estou desistindo do programa, por uma pena, não sei se é fatalidade, mas cheguei ao meu ápice da ansiedade. Quando me inscrevi, queria fazer história e brilhar", disse ele no confessionário ao sair do programa.

ENQUETE UOL BBB 23: Com a saída de Bruno, você acha que deveria entrar um novo participante?

Resultado parcial

Total de 3322 votos
57,28%
Reprodução/Globoplay